Forestland — Area — UNFCCC in Germany
Germany: Forestland — Area — UNFCCC was 10,885 1000 ha in 2022. ▬ Flat
Forestland — Area — UNFCCC in Germany, 1990–2022
Source: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ations. Measured in 1000 ha.
Analysis
The most recent figure for forestland — area — unfccc in Germany is 10,885 1000 ha, measured in 2022. That is the highest value across all 33 years on record.
The figure is up 0.1% on the previous year and up 0.6% over ten years.
Over the whole period, forestland — area — unfccc in Germany peaked at 10,885 1000 ha in 2022 and was at its lowest, 10,690 1000 ha, in 1990.
Germany ranks 25th of 77 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

About this data
The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ions from Forests consists of CO2 emissions and removals corresponding to forest carbon stock changes (aboveground and belowground living biomass). Estimates are computed following the 2006 IPCC Guidelines for National Greenhouse Gas Inventories (IPCC, 2006).
